工程项目管理软件原型图怎么做?从需求分析到交互设计全流程解析
在数字化转型浪潮中,工程项目管理软件已成为建筑、基建、制造等行业提升效率的核心工具。而一个成功的软件项目,往往始于一张清晰、可落地的原型图。那么,工程项目管理软件原型图究竟该如何制作?本文将从需求收集、功能规划、交互设计到工具选择等维度,系统拆解全过程,帮助你打造既专业又实用的原型图,为后续开发打下坚实基础。
一、为什么要重视工程项目管理软件原型图?
原型图(Prototype)是产品设计阶段的可视化蓝图,它不是最终成品,而是介于概念与代码之间的“高保真模型”。对于工程项目管理软件而言,其复杂性远超普通办公工具:涉及进度计划、资源调度、成本控制、风险预警、多方协作等多个模块。若缺乏前期原型设计,极易出现以下问题:
- 功能冗余或缺失:开发团队根据模糊需求实现功能,后期返工成本极高。
- 用户体验差:用户界面混乱、操作路径不清晰,导致一线工程师拒绝使用。
- 沟通障碍:项目经理、技术负责人、客户三方对“要做什么”理解不一致。
因此,一份高质量的原型图,是确保项目成功的第一道防线——它让抽象需求变得具象,让团队达成共识,让开发有据可依。
二、第一步:深入挖掘真实需求——别让“伪需求”误导方向
很多团队跳过需求调研直接画原型,结果做出来的软件成了“自嗨式产品”。正确的做法是:
1. 明确目标用户画像
工程项目管理软件的目标用户通常包括:
- 项目经理:关注进度跟踪、资源调配、预算控制。
- 施工员/监理:需要现场签到、任务分配、问题上报功能。
- 财务人员:需集成成本核算、发票管理、合同付款节点提醒。
- 高层管理者:看重数据看板、风险预警、多项目协同分析。
不同角色的操作习惯和痛点差异巨大,必须分别访谈,才能提炼出真正的需求。
2. 使用场景化提问法
不要问“你们希望有什么功能”,而要问:“请描述一下你上周五下午三点处理某项变更申请的完整流程。”这种具体场景的追问,能暴露流程断点、信息孤岛等问题。
3. 建立优先级矩阵
将收集到的需求按“紧急度 × 价值”打分,区分MVP(最小可行产品)核心功能与未来迭代内容。例如,甘特图展示进度、任务派发、审批流是MVP必备;而BIM模型集成、AI预测工期则可作为V2版本。
三、第二步:构建功能框架——从宏观到微观的设计逻辑
有了清晰的需求后,下一步就是搭建功能结构。建议采用“功能树 + 用户旅程地图”的组合方式:
1. 功能树梳理(Functional Tree)
以“项目管理”为核心节点,向下展开一级功能:
- 项目创建与配置
- 进度管理(甘特图、里程碑)
- 资源管理(人力、设备、材料)
- 成本控制(预算设定、实际支出对比)
- 质量管理(检查清单、整改闭环)
- 安全管理(隐患登记、培训记录)
- 文档管理(图纸、合同、会议纪要)
- 移动端支持(扫码报工、定位打卡)
再对每个一级功能进行二级细化,如“进度管理”下可拆分为:任务创建、依赖关系设置、进度更新、延误预警等。
2. 用户旅程地图(User Journey Map)
针对典型用户角色,绘制其完成关键任务的全流程。比如:
- 项目经理启动新项目 → 设置组织架构 → 分配角色权限
- 施工员接收到每日任务 → 现场拍照上传 → 提交完成状态
- 财务核对本月支出 → 自动同步至预算表 → 发起报销审批
通过旅程地图,可以识别出哪些步骤繁琐、是否需要自动化或简化,从而指导原型图中的页面布局和交互逻辑。
四、第三步:动手制作原型图——工具选择与设计要点
现在市面上主流原型工具各有优劣,推荐以下三种:
1. Axure RP(适合复杂工程类项目)
优势:支持动态交互、条件逻辑、变量计算,非常适合模拟复杂的审批流、成本波动提醒等功能。缺点:学习曲线较陡,适合有一定设计经验的团队。
2. Figma(适合敏捷协作)
优势:云端协作实时性强,支持多人同时编辑、评论反馈;组件库丰富,便于统一风格;免费版功能已足够满足大多数项目需求。
3. Mockplus / 墨刀(适合快速验证)
优势:拖拽式操作简单易上手,内置大量模板,适合初创团队快速产出低保真原型用于内部评审。
设计要点:
- 遵循“用户为中心”原则:所有页面元素应围绕用户核心动作展开,如任务列表页优先显示待办事项而非历史记录。
- 一致性设计:保持按钮样式、颜色、字体统一,减少认知负担。
- 层级清晰:主功能入口不超过3层,避免用户迷失在菜单中。
- 标注交互细节:对悬停效果、点击跳转、错误提示等行为进行说明,方便开发者理解意图。
五、第四步:测试与迭代——让原型成为真正的“试金石”
原型图不是一次性产物,而是一个持续优化的过程。建议执行以下步骤:
1. 内部评审会
邀请产品经理、UI设计师、前端开发共同参与,逐页审查逻辑合理性与可行性,重点关注:
• 是否存在功能冲突?
• 操作路径是否符合直觉?
• 数据字段命名是否专业且易懂?
2. 用户可用性测试(Usability Test)
找5-8位真实用户(最好是不同岗位),让他们在无引导的情况下使用原型,观察其操作路径、卡顿点、疑问点,并记录反馈。例如:“我在查看进度时找不到昨天的任务记录”说明导航层级不合理。
3. 快速迭代
根据测试结果修改原型,每轮迭代控制在3天内完成。注意:每次只改一个问题,避免引入新bug。
六、案例分享:某市政工程公司如何用原型图赢得客户信任
一家专注于城市道路改造的工程公司,在开发自己的项目管理系统时,最初仅靠Excel表格管理进度,效率低下且难以共享。他们决定委托第三方团队开发定制化软件。
合作初期,对方未充分调研,直接给出了一个功能繁杂的原型方案。客户表示:“我们根本用不了这么多功能,而且看不懂。”后来,项目组重新启动,采用上述方法:
- 访谈了12名一线工人、6名项目经理、3名财务人员;
- 绘制了3个典型用户旅程地图;
- 用Figma制作了两个版本原型,第一个强调简洁,第二个增加高级功能;
- 邀请客户代表进行可用性测试,最终选择第一个版本。
最终上线的系统因界面友好、流程顺畅,获得高度评价,甚至被推广至集团其他子公司使用。
结语:好的原型图,是通往成功的桥梁
工程项目管理软件原型图不是简单的线框图,它是连接业务需求与技术实现的桥梁,是降低沟通成本、提升开发效率的关键环节。无论你是企业内部产品经理、独立开发者还是外包团队,掌握这一套系统化的原型设计方法,都能让你的产品更贴近用户的实际工作场景,真正做到“有用、好用、爱用”。记住:一个好的原型图,胜过千言万语的口头描述。





